ImageMagick-6.5.7-9 IPTC information can not be extracted

Description

ImageMagick is not able to extract IPTC information from pictures. According to my tests this failure is related to the XMP format used in different Adobe apps. While the IPTC information from Photoshop CS3 with Adobe XMP Core 4.1-c036 can be extracted it is not possible to read the IPTC from Bridge CS3 and Bridge CS4 (Adobe XMP Core 4.2-c020) or Photoshop CS4 (Adobe XMP Core 4.2.2-c063).
